在Java开发中,组件坐标(也称为依赖坐标)的设置与优化是确保项目稳定性和性能的关键环节。阿里云作为国内领先的云计算服务商,提供了丰富的工具和服务来帮助开发者高效地管理Java组件。本文将详细介绍如何在阿里云服务中设置和优化Java组件坐标。
一、阿里云服务简介
阿里云是国内领先的云计算服务商,提供包括弹性计算、存储、数据库、大数据处理、人工智能等在内的全方位云计算服务。对于Java开发者来说,阿里云提供了以下几款与Java开发相关的服务:
- 阿里云Elastic Compute Service (ECS):提供弹性计算服务,可以快速部署Java应用。
- 阿里云容器服务 (ACK):支持容器化部署Java应用,提高应用的可移植性和可扩展性。
- 阿里云Maven仓库:提供丰富的Java组件仓库,方便开发者查找和使用。
二、Java组件坐标设置
Java组件坐标包括groupId、artifactId和version三个部分,用于唯一标识一个组件。在阿里云服务中,设置Java组件坐标通常有以下几种方式:
1. 使用Maven仓库
阿里云Maven仓库提供了丰富的Java组件,开发者可以在项目的pom.xml文件中直接添加以下配置:
<repositories>
<repository>
<id>aliyun-maven</id>
<url>https://maven.aliyun.com/repository/central</url>
</repository>
</repositories>
2. 使用阿里云容器服务ACK
在阿里云容器服务ACK中,可以通过以下步骤设置Java组件坐标:
- 登录阿里云容器服务ACK控制台。
- 创建一个新的应用或编辑现有应用。
- 在应用的配置中,找到“组件配置”部分,添加或修改组件坐标。
3. 使用阿里云ECS
在阿里云ECS中,可以通过以下步骤设置Java组件坐标:
- 登录阿里云ECS控制台。
- 创建一个新实例或编辑现有实例。
- 在实例的配置中,找到“镜像”部分,选择一个包含所需Java组件的镜像。
三、Java组件坐标优化技巧
为了提高Java应用的性能和稳定性,以下是一些优化Java组件坐标的技巧:
1. 选择合适的版本
在设置Java组件坐标时,应选择与项目兼容的版本。可以通过以下方式选择合适的版本:
- 查看组件的官方文档,了解不同版本的特性和兼容性。
- 查看其他开发者的评价和反馈,了解不同版本的优缺点。
2. 使用最新版本
尽量使用最新版本的Java组件,以获取最新的特性和修复的漏洞。但要注意,最新版本可能存在兼容性问题,需要谨慎使用。
3. 避免使用过时版本
过时版本的Java组件可能存在安全漏洞和性能问题,应尽量避免使用。
4. 使用阿里云Maven仓库
阿里云Maven仓库提供了丰富的Java组件,可以方便地查找和使用。同时,阿里云Maven仓库还提供了组件的版本信息和依赖关系,有助于开发者更好地管理组件。
四、总结
在阿里云服务中,设置和优化Java组件坐标是确保项目稳定性和性能的关键环节。通过使用阿里云提供的工具和服务,开发者可以轻松地管理Java组件,提高开发效率。希望本文能帮助您更好地掌握Java组件坐标设置与优化技巧。
